About

  • Mr. Koense is a member of the Delaware County, Chester County and Pennsylvania Bar Associations, and the Doris Jonas Freed Matrimonial Inns of Court
  • As a member of the Family Law Section, Mr. Koense was co-chairman of the Protection From Abuse Committee for the Family Law Section of the Delaware County Bar Association (2001 to 2003)
  • chair of the Technology Committee for the Family Law Section of the Delaware County Bar Association (2003 – 2006)
  • Treasurer for the Family Law Section (2007-2009; 2012-present)
  • Vice Chairperson for the Family Law Section (2010)
  • and was the Chairperson of the Family Law Section (2011)
  • As a member of the Doris Jonas Freed Inn of Court, Mr. Koense served as past President of the Inn, and remains an active member of the Inn of Court, presenting on various Family Law topics to other members of the Bench and the Bar
  • In addition to his commitment to the Delaware County Family Law Section and Inn of Court, Mr. Koense is also actively involved with the Women’s Resource Center in Wayne, PA providing legal advice to women in need and organizing free legal seminars on divorce practice and procedure, as well as general divorce topics
  • Mr. Koense graduated with a bachelor’s degree from the University of Delaware in 1993
  • He graduated from Widener University School of Law in 1997, and was the President of the Student Bar Association from 1996 -1997
